Resumen
This paper makes a description of Adherence to the Mediterranean Diet as a Nutritional Model, measured through the KIDMED questionnaire, carried out to UPTC Physical Education Students in the period 2020-2, in the periods before the pandemic and during the pandemic, with the purpose of describing the quality of the students' diet and the changes that occurred with the return of students home due to the pandemic, as a strategy from health education focused on promoting styles of healthy lives, taking into account that the beginning of university life leads to a number of changes in lifestyle and in the way of eating for many young people, having to leave home to go to study in another city, Which explains that some young people deteriorate the quality of their diet and acquire bad eating habits by preferring fast or industrial foods or avoiding the consumption of fruits and vegetables, either for reasons s economic or time allocation. We find very interesting data that we compare with other Colombian studies that have also used the KIDMED in university students.
